U.S. Faces Extended Delay in Replenishing Weapons Stockpiles Depleted by Iran War

New analyses indicate that the U.S. will require several years to restore advanced weapon stockpiles significantly depleted during the conflict in Iran. This shortage poses a potential vulnerability for the U.S. military as it prepares for future conflicts, particularly against China. Moreover, the delay in munitions, including Tomahawk missiles, is expected to severely impact allies such as Japan. As the U.S. recovers, experts warn that this situation might create opportunities for adversaries.
